Living in PO16 0LP offers convenient access to major retail and transport hubs without the need to travel far. You have five retail options nearby, including Tesco Fareham, Iceland Fareham, and Morrisons Daily Fareham 107. These stores provide for your weekly grocery runs and household essentials. Travel by rail is simplified with five stations within practical reach, including Fareham Railway Station, Portchester Railway Station, and Swanwick Railway Station. You can catch a train from any of these locations for inter-town connections. Ferry access remains strong with five terminals nearby, such as Portsmouth International Cruise and Ferry Terminal and Gosport Ferry Terminal. These venues link you directly to Portsmouth and Gosport by boat. You visit local shops in Fareham multiple times per week and reach the coast quickly.
